Sometimes the smallest adjustments create the biggest changes in Your Pilates practice.
A movement can look almost identical from the outside, but one small change in positioning can completely change which muscles are doing the work. đŞ
Thatâs why Pilates is about so much more than simply completing a movement. Itâs about understanding how You move.
⨠Bridging
Avoid arching through Your lower back when in the Bridging position. Keep shoulders, hips and knees in line - rib cage soft, no flaring.
⨠Ab Curls
Avoid leading with Your chin and neck. Initaite the movement with the abdominals - draw the ribs to hips and lifting with the chest. No momentum.
⨠Lunges
Maintain good knee alignment - keep the shin bone vertical to the floor - knee stays over ankle.
